I've been on Twitter for some time, and generally speaking I hate social networking stuff. Not into Facebook, don't do any of that stuff for the most part.
I'm a web designer so I'm on a computer all day anyway and Twitter has turned out to be hugely helpful. I can ask a question and get an answer or link from dozens of people within minutes. It has turned out to be a huge time saver on occasion, but also a huge time waster just trying to keep up. Oddly enough you get to know some cool people and I've found a number of freelance design jobs through it and made some great work connections. |
